These crashes seem to happen on various pieces of Nvidia hardware (most but not of them old) across multiple versions of Mesa, spanning the 20.x and 21.x releases. The crash is caused by an assertion in libdrm so I don't think we can do anything about it. I'm filing it in order to track the volume. If it's a genuine bug in Mesa I expect the volume to go down, but if it goes up we should probably inform upstream.
